I just started my profession as software developer..I want to make some educational softwares..I have referred/ used some old books...I have modified their content for my purpose...My software will not affect their business...Should i take permission from author of book ? I am confuesd...what is fair use policy in this ?Can author claim my software future ? please help me.
Under the doctrine of fair use, there is an exception to use copyright for non-profit educational purposes.
However, it also depends upon the quantum of copyrighted material used.
Preferably, give them credit and get a permit to use the copyrighted material.
